Parallel hybrid electric vehicles (HEV) can be classified according to the location of the electric motor with respect to the transmission unit for the internal combustion engine (ICE): they can be pre-transmission or posttransmission parallel hybrid.

Energy Management Strategy for Atkinson Cycle Engine Based Parallel Hybrid Electric Vehicle
Energy management strategies are widely used for the fuel efficiency of hybrid electric vehicle (HEV). Most of the on road hybrid cars use Atkinson cycle engine instead of Otto cycle engine, on account of better efficiency.
